Marrakech vs Kowloon, Hong Kong Climate & Distance Between

Hong Kong flag
  • The distance between Marrakech, Morocco and Kowloon, Hong Kong, Hong Kong is approximately 11,427 km or 7,101 mi.
  • To reach Marrakech in this distance one would set out from Kowloon, Hong Kong bearing 312.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Marrakech bearing 233.4° or SW .
  • Marrakech has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Kowloon, Hong Kong has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
  • The annual average temperature is 3.4 °C (6.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.1 °C (5.6°F) more in Marrakech.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1933.7 mm (76.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1933.7 l/m² (47.46 US gal/ft²) or 19,337,000 l/ha (2,067,254 US gal/ac) less. About 1/8 as much.
  • There are 1182 more hours of sunlight per year in Marrakech. In whichever way circa 3h 14' more per day or about 1 3/5 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9° lower in Marrakech than in Kowloon, Hong Kong.
  • Relative humidity levels are 17.3%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 7.2°C (13°F) lower.
